परिचय
डेटा प्रबंधन और भंडारण की दुनिया ने पिछले कुछ वर्षों में महत्वपूर्ण विकास देखा है, और एक आधारभूत स्तंभ जो समय की कसौटी पर खरा उतरा है, वह है रिलेशनल डेटाबेस। यह लेख रिलेशनल डेटाबेस की गहराई में जाता है, उनके इतिहास, संरचना, विशेषताओं, प्रकारों, अनुप्रयोगों और भविष्य की संभावनाओं की खोज करता है। इसके अलावा, हम प्रॉक्सी सर्वर और रिलेशनल डेटाबेस के दिलचस्प अंतर्संबंध पर चर्चा करेंगे, उनके संभावित तालमेल पर प्रकाश डालेंगे।
रिलेशनल डेटाबेस की उत्पत्ति
रिलेशनल डेटाबेस की अवधारणा को सबसे पहले डॉ. एडगर एफ. कॉड ने 1970 में प्रकाशित "ए रिलेशनल मॉडल ऑफ़ डेटा फ़ॉर लार्ज शेयर्ड डेटा बैंक्स" नामक एक महत्वपूर्ण पेपर में पेश किया था। इस पेपर ने तालिकाओं, पंक्तियों और स्तंभों का उपयोग करके संरचित तरीके से डेटा को व्यवस्थित और प्रबंधित करने की नींव रखी। कॉड के दूरदर्शी विचारों ने पहले वाणिज्यिक रिलेशनल डेटाबेस सिस्टम के विकास का मार्ग प्रशस्त किया।
आंतरिक कार्यप्रणाली का अनावरण
रिलेशनल डेटाबेस डेटा को सारणीबद्ध रूप में संग्रहीत करता है, जहाँ डेटा को पूर्वनिर्धारित स्तंभों के साथ तालिकाओं में व्यवस्थित किया जाता है जो विशेषताओं का प्रतिनिधित्व करते हैं और पंक्तियाँ व्यक्तिगत रिकॉर्ड रखती हैं। तालिकाओं के बीच संबंध कुंजियों के माध्यम से स्थापित किए जाते हैं, मुख्य रूप से प्राथमिक कुंजी और विदेशी कुंजियाँ। यह संरचना डेटा अखंडता को बढ़ावा देती है, अतिरेक को कम करती है, और संरचित क्वेरी भाषा (SQL) के माध्यम से क्वेरी करने की सुविधा प्रदान करती है। ACID (परमाणुता, संगति, अलगाव, स्थायित्व) गुण डेटा विश्वसनीयता और लेनदेन प्रबंधन सुनिश्चित करते हैं।
प्रमुख विशेषताओं का अन्वेषण किया गया
रिलेशनल डेटाबेस कई प्रमुख विशेषताएं प्रदान करते हैं जो उनके व्यापक रूप से अपनाए जाने में योगदान देती हैं:
- आंकड़ा शुचिता: बाधाओं के उपयोग के माध्यम से, रिलेशनल डेटाबेस डेटा की सटीकता और स्थिरता बनाए रखते हैं।
- क्वेरी भाषा (एसक्यूएल): SQL उपयोगकर्ताओं को डेटाबेस के साथ इंटरैक्ट करने, जटिल क्वेरीज़ करने और विशिष्ट डेटा पुनः प्राप्त करने में सक्षम बनाता है।
- सामान्यीकरण: डेटा को छोटी-छोटी, संबंधित तालिकाओं में विभाजित करने की प्रक्रिया से अतिरेक कम हो जाता है और दक्षता बढ़ जाती है।
- स्केलेबिलिटी: रिलेशनल डेटाबेस को ऊर्ध्वाधर रूप से (एकल सर्वर में अधिक संसाधन जोड़कर) या क्षैतिज रूप से (कई सर्वरों में डेटा वितरित करके) बढ़ाया जा सकता है।
- सुरक्षा: पहुँच नियंत्रण, प्रमाणीकरण और प्राधिकरण तंत्र डेटा सुरक्षा सुनिश्चित करते हैं और अनधिकृत पहुँच को रोकते हैं।
रिलेशनल डेटाबेस के विविध प्रकार
रिलेशनल डेटाबेस विभिन्न प्रकार के होते हैं, जो अलग-अलग ज़रूरतों और उपयोग के मामलों को पूरा करते हैं। निम्न तालिका में कुछ लोकप्रिय प्रकारों पर प्रकाश डाला गया है:
प्रकार | विवरण |
---|---|
माई एसक्यूएल | एक ओपन-सोर्स RDBMS जो अपनी गति, विश्वसनीयता और उपयोग में आसानी के लिए जाना जाता है। |
पोस्टग्रेएसक्यूएल | एक शक्तिशाली, एक्सटेंसिबल RDBMS जो उन्नत डेटा प्रकारों और सुविधाओं के समर्थन के लिए प्रसिद्ध है। |
माइक्रोसॉफ्ट एसक्यूएल सर्वर | माइक्रोसॉफ्ट द्वारा निर्मित एक व्यापक RDBMS जो उच्च प्रदर्शन और विंडोज सिस्टम के साथ एकीकरण प्रदान करता है। |
ओरेकल डाटाबेस | एक सुविधा संपन्न RDBMS जो अपनी मापनीयता, सुरक्षा और उन्नत विश्लेषण क्षमताओं के लिए जाना जाता है। |
अनुप्रयोग और चुनौतियाँ
रिलेशनल डेटाबेस का उपयोग ई-कॉमर्स, वित्त, स्वास्थ्य सेवा और अन्य कई क्षेत्रों में किया जाता है। हालाँकि, बड़े डेटासेट को संभालने के लिए स्केलिंग, जटिल डेटा संबंध और कठोर स्कीमा संशोधन जैसी चुनौतियाँ उत्पन्न हो सकती हैं। शार्डिंग (कई सर्वरों में डेटा का विभाजन) और डीनॉर्मलाइज़ेशन (क्वेरी प्रदर्शन को बेहतर बनाने के लिए तालिकाओं को संयोजित करना) जैसे समाधान इन चुनौतियों का समाधान करते हैं।
तुलनात्मक अंतर्दृष्टि
रिलेशनल डेटाबेस को बेहतर ढंग से समझने के लिए, आइए उनकी तुलना कुछ संबंधित शब्दों से करें:
अवधि | विवरण |
---|---|
नोएसक्यूएल डेटाबेस | असंरचित या अर्ध-संरचित डेटा के लिए डिज़ाइन किया गया, जो उच्च मापनीयता प्रदान करता है। |
ग्राफ़ डेटाबेस | डेटा बिंदुओं के बीच संबंधों पर ध्यान केंद्रित करें, जो सामाजिक नेटवर्क जैसे परिदृश्यों के लिए आदर्श है। |
ऑब्जेक्ट-रिलेशनल मैपिंग (ORM) | प्रोग्रामिंग भाषाओं और रिलेशनल डेटाबेस के बीच बातचीत को सुविधाजनक बनाता है। |
भविष्य के क्षितिज
रिलेशनल डेटाबेस का भविष्य आशाजनक है, जिसमें निम्नलिखित क्षेत्रों में निरंतर प्रगति हो रही है:
- क्लाउड एकीकरण: उन्नत मापनीयता और पहुंच के लिए रिलेशनल डेटाबेस का क्लाउड वातावरण में निर्बाध स्थानांतरण।
- मशीन लर्निंग एकीकरण: वास्तविक समय की अंतर्दृष्टि और पूर्वानुमानात्मक विश्लेषण के लिए मशीन लर्निंग मॉडल को डेटाबेस में एकीकृत करना।
- ब्लॉकचेन एकीकरण: डेटा सुरक्षा और अपरिवर्तनीयता को बढ़ाने के लिए ब्लॉकचेन प्रौद्योगिकी को शामिल करना।
प्रॉक्सी सर्वर और रिलेशनल डेटाबेस का गठजोड़
OneProxy द्वारा प्रदान किए गए प्रॉक्सी सर्वर, डेटा प्रबंधन और सुरक्षा में महत्वपूर्ण भूमिका निभाते हैं। वे क्लाइंट और सर्वर के बीच मध्यस्थ के रूप में कार्य करते हैं, गुमनामी और बढ़ी हुई सुरक्षा प्रदान करते हैं। जब रिलेशनल डेटाबेस की बात आती है, तो प्रॉक्सी सर्वर ये कर सकते हैं:
- सुरक्षा बढ़ाएँ: प्रॉक्सी सर्वर सुरक्षा की एक अतिरिक्त परत जोड़ सकते हैं, डेटाबेस तक पहुंच को नियंत्रित कर सकते हैं और इसके स्थान को छुपा सकते हैं।
- भार का संतुलन: प्रॉक्सी सर्वर आने वाले डेटाबेस अनुरोधों को समान रूप से वितरित कर सकते हैं, जिससे प्रदर्शन और संसाधन उपयोग को अनुकूलित किया जा सकता है।
- कैशिंग: प्रॉक्सी सर्वर बार-बार एक्सेस किए जाने वाले डेटा को कैश कर सकते हैं, जिससे डेटाबेस पर लोड कम हो जाता है और प्रतिक्रिया समय में सुधार होता है।
सम्बंधित लिंक्स
रिलेशनल डेटाबेस के बारे में अधिक जानकारी के लिए आप निम्नलिखित संसाधनों का संदर्भ ले सकते हैं:
निष्कर्ष
रिलेशनल डेटाबेस ने डेटा को प्रबंधित करने, व्यवस्थित करने और उपयोग करने के तरीके में क्रांति ला दी है। 1970 के दशक में अपनी शुरुआत से लेकर विभिन्न उद्योगों में अपने वर्तमान अनुप्रयोगों तक, ये डेटाबेस आधुनिक डेटा प्रबंधन की आधारशिला बने हुए हैं। जैसे-जैसे तकनीक विकसित होती जा रही है, रिलेशनल डेटाबेस नई चुनौतियों और अवसरों का सामना करने के लिए खुद को ढाल रहे हैं, जो डेटा-संचालित निर्णय लेने के भविष्य को आकार दे रहे हैं। प्रॉक्सी सर्वर की क्षमता के साथ संयुक्त होने पर, उनकी क्षमताएँ और भी आगे बढ़ जाती हैं, जो एक दूसरे से जुड़े डिजिटल परिदृश्य में बढ़ी हुई सुरक्षा और दक्षता का वादा करती हैं।